BlackBerry (TSE:BB) Shares Down 14.2% on Insider Selling

BlackBerry Limited (TSE:BBGet Free Report) (NASDAQ:BBRY)’s stock price dropped 14.2% during mid-day trading on Thursday after an insider sold shares in the company. The company traded as low as C$12.80 and last traded at C$12.84. Approximately 6,118,081 shares traded hands during trading, an increase of 55% from the average daily volume of 3,937,589 shares. The stock had previously closed at C$14.97.

Specifically, insider Philip Simon Kurtz sold 30,000 shares of the firm’s stock in a transaction that occurred on Tuesday, July 14th. The shares were sold at an average price of C$15.92, for a total transaction of C$477,600.00. Following the completion of the sale, the insider owned 95,158 shares of the company’s stock, valued at approximately C$1,514,915.36. This trade represents a 23.97% decrease in their ownership of the stock.

BlackBerry (NYSE:BB)(TSX:BB) provides enterprises and governments the intelligent software and services that power the world around us. Based in Waterloo, Ontario, the company’s high-performance foundational software enables major automakers and industrial giants alike to unlock transformative applications, drive new revenue streams and launch innovative business models, all without sacrificing safety, security, and reliability. With a deep heritage in Secure Communications, BlackBerry delivers operational resiliency with a comprehensive, highly secure, and extensively certified portfolio for mobile fortification, mission-critical communications, and critical events management.
